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Игры";
Текущий архив: 2004.03.09;
Скачать: [xml.tar.bz2];

Вниз

Direction и Position у GLCamera???   Найти похожие ветки 

 
Sacred   (2003-08-20 02:34) [0]

Здрасть!
Уважаемые спецы в этом деле, не могли бы вы разьяснить в чем разница между Direction и Position у камера.Просто мне нужно сдеать несколько видов, так как сделать чтобы камера находилась на оси Y и смотрела вниз?
Заранее спасибо.


 
Hyboid   (2003-08-20 04:08) [1]

А что в OpenGL разве есть объект такой "camera" ?
Но я так понимаю, что
Direction - направление камеры;
Position - месторасположение камеры;
Для однозначного определения камеры должен быть еще один вектор
типа Up - т.е. "верх" камеры.

З.Ы. Сам обычно использую конструкцию something like this:

glMatrixMode( GL_PROJECTION );
gluLookAt( eye.x, eye.y, eye.z, {Положение камеры
в мировых координатах}
center.x, center.y, center.z,{Координаты точки в
мировых координатах,
на которую направлена
камера}
up.x, up.y, up.z ); {Вектор "вверх" у камеры}


 
Sacred   (2003-08-20 23:24) [2]

Я работаю с компонентами GLSCENE.Там есть камера, только вот не могу сделать несколько видов.


 
SdlWin   (2003-08-21 01:02) [3]

Под "вектором вверх" он подразумевает наклон.

А ты попробуй кидануть на формочку побольше TGLSceneViewer"ов;


 
Sacred   (2003-08-22 00:31) [4]

в том все и дело что у меня TGLSceneViewer"ов будет 4 штуки и на каждом надо отобразить ту или иную проекцию,но камера не распологаеться, на пример на оси Х и она должна смотреть в центр


 
DeadMeat   (2003-08-23 16:55) [5]

>Sacred
Засунь объекты, на которые тебе надо смотреть в один GLDummyCube, и у камеры поставь свойство TargetObject на этот GLDummyCube... После этого тебе будет легче пользоваться только свойство Position, при этом куда бы ты не поставил камеру, она всегда будет смотреть на эти объекты...
Иначе засунь камеру в GLDummyCube, включи у него свойство ShowAxes, и поиграй со свойством Direction... Только играй осторожно, потому-что если ты её раскрутишь как-нибудь не так, то обратно вернуть камеру будет не так легко...
Удачи



Страницы: 1 вся ветка

Форум: "Игры";
Текущий архив: 2004.03.09;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.45 MB
Время: 0.007 c
3-25701
guest_Dmitry
2004-02-10 16:28
2004.03.09
MS Jet + XP - кривые руки или глюк?


6-25844
asdqwer
2003-12-29 18:19
2004.03.09
WebBrowser.Document.All.Tags


1-25796
Ш-К
2004-02-26 09:40
2004.03.09
Работа с классами


1-25795
Mixa3
2004-02-27 09:09
2004.03.09
Как записать строку в record?


3-25687
harisma
2004-02-11 11:08
2004.03.09
Подстановка значентй в DBGride





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ский